Backend Developer C++

We not only apply cutting-edge technology. We create it.

We’re looking for a new Backend Developer to join our Network team.

As member of the Network team, you will help to design, develop and maintain performant and scalable products used by our business customers; you'll deep dive into challenging and exciting brainstorming and pair-programming sessions with your teammates and, most importantly, you'll be part of the future of the cloud.

What you’ll do

  • Work on existing and new products by developing software, of course
  • Review other teammates’ code and constructively discuss about changes
  • Transform technical requirements into tasks to be worked on
  • Analyze application’s tracing to spot bottlenecks and issues

What you’ll need

  • Medium seniority (3+ years of experience in same role)
  • Knowledge of C++ (C++20)
  • Understanding of cloud services 
  • Experience with Git
  • Experience with GDB/LLDB
  • Experience with networking (sockets, HTTP)
  • Experience in writing linux applications
  • Solid spoken and written English communication skills
  • Master degree in computer engineering or similar

Bonus point

  • Past experience in startup and/or similar industry
  • Past experience in remote working with agile/scrum methodology
  • Docker
  • Kubernetes
  • Kafka
  • Bazel
  • Datadog, OpenTelemetry, application tracing
  • Rust
  • P2P network topologies and distributed consensus algorithms

Profile and mindset

  • Solid spoken and written English communication skills.
  • Obsessive attention to details: you’re meticulous in ensuring that your work is of the highest quality.
  • You’re a quick and deep learner: you don’t stop at the surface, but find enjoyment in exploring what lies beneath and becoming a master of your trade.
  • You’re also a team player: you understand that the power of the Swarm is more than the sum of its parts.

Email & Application process

We evaluate you based on your skills. 

If you want to be part of our team: contact us!

Please apply even if your experience and interests aren't an exact match with what we've laid out in this job description. We're building something different at Cubbit. 

If that sounds interesting, we want to hear from you.

Apply
Or send your application at careers@cubbit.io
By applying to one of our open positions and by submitting your personal data to us, you acknowledge that you have read and understood this Privacy Notice and agree to the use of your personal data as set out herein.
Work location:
Full remote or hybrid (possibility to work in our offices in Bologna, Italy)
Experience:
Medium seniority (3+ years of experience in the same role)
Published on:
January 22, 2024